A Farmer’s Road

SYNOPSIS

A Farmer’s Road tells the story of how two PhD soil scientists traded the security of academic tenure for the challenges and economic uncertainty of operating a goat dairy and farmstead creamery in Illinois. Surrounded by commodity-based agribusiness, they strive to embody the principles of sustainability, showcasing artisan products during slow-food dinners. Their mission to educate the public about small-farm diversity is changing the American food system one meal at a time.
